The Reality of Modern Search
Most SEO Programs Stall in the First Six Months
Rankings aren’t random. When SEO underperforms, it’s almost always one of three things: technical debt blocking crawlers from seeing your best pages, thin content that doesn’t answer the queries it targets, or weak authority from a backlink profile that hasn’t kept pace with competitors.
We diagnose all three on day one, then build a roadmap with clear monthly outputs — not vague “we’re working on it” status updates.
- Pages that rank but don’t convert (or convert but don’t rank)
- Technical issues that quietly de-index high-value content
- Backlink profiles built from low-quality, throwaway directories

The Six Pillars of Sustainable SEO
Technical SEO
Crawlability, indexability, site architecture, Core Web Vitals, schema, and the dozen quiet things that block rankings before content ever has a chance.
On-Page SEO
Title tags, meta descriptions, H1 hierarchy, internal linking, and content optimization aligned to actual search intent — not just keyword density.
Content Strategy
Topic clusters, content briefs, editorial calendars, and intent mapping. Built to earn rankings, not chase them.
Off-Page SEO
Authority building through digital PR, strategic outreach, and earned links from publications that actually move the rankings needle.
Local SEO
Google Business Profile optimization, citation cleanup, review strategy, and geo-targeted content for businesses with physical service areas.
Analytics & Reporting
GA4, Search Console, and Looker Studio dashboards that tie organic performance to revenue — not just rankings.

Directional movement (impressions, indexation, technical wins) shows within 4–8 weeks. Meaningful ranking and traffic shifts typically land between months 4 and 6. Anyone promising page-one rankings in week three is not telling you the truth.
Paid search (PPC) buys placement instantly and stops the moment your budget runs out. SEO earns placement over time through technical, content, and authority work — and continues to deliver traffic long after the active engagement ends. The two work best together.
Yes — through digital PR, strategic outreach, and earned placements on publications relevant to your industry. We don’t buy links from PBNs, exchange networks, or anywhere else that puts your domain at risk.
Usually, yes — but not always linearly. SEO traffic compounds, so months 1–3 may look slow before months 4–6 show steeper gains. We track leading indicators (impressions, click-through rate, indexed pages) so you can see progress before traffic catches up.
